Multiplication in math is one of the most important basic arithmetic operations you will ever learn. It is used everywhere—school, shopping, time calculation, money counting, and even in technology.
But let’s keep it simple.
👉 Multiplication means adding the same number again and again in an easy shortcut way.
Instead of writing:
- 5 + 5 + 5 + 5
We write:
- 5 × 4 = 20
That’s it.
So multiplication helps us calculate faster, cleaner, and smarter.

Let’s Understand Multiplication Using Real Life (No Confusion Now)
Imagine you have:
🍎 3 baskets
🍎 Each basket has 4 apples
Instead of adding:
- 4 + 4 + 4
You use multiplication:
- 3 × 4 = 12 apples
This idea is called equal groups multiplication.
Here are more real-life examples:
- 2 pens in 5 boxes → 2 × 5 = 10 pens
- 6 students in 3 rows → 6 × 3 = 18 students
- 10 rupees × 4 coins → 40 rupees
- 7 days × 24 hours → 168 hours
So multiplication is just a faster way to handle repeated numbers in daily life.
What Do the Numbers in Multiplication Mean? (Very Important)
Let’s break it like a teacher:
In:
👉 6 × 3 = 18
- 6 = number in each group
- 3 = number of groups
- 18 = total answer (called product)
This is how multiplication “thinks”.
Other important math terms:
- Multiplicand → first number
- Multiplier → second number
- Product → final answer
Even if the words sound big, the idea is very simple.

Visual Learning: Arrays (Super Important for Understanding)
Now let’s make multiplication visual.
An array is rows and columns.
Example:
👉 3 × 4 array
Means:
- 3 rows
- 4 columns
Like this:
⬛⬛⬛⬛
⬛⬛⬛⬛
⬛⬛⬛⬛
Total = 12 blocks

Important Properties of Multiplication (Top Scoring Concept)
Now let’s learn the rules that make multiplication powerful.
Commutative Property (Order Doesn’t Matter)
👉 3 × 4 = 12
👉 4 × 3 = 12
So order does not change answer.

Identity Property (Multiply by 1)
👉 7 × 1 = 7
Anything multiplied by 1 stays the same.

Zero Property (Multiply by 0)
👉 9 × 0 = 0
Anything multiplied by zero becomes zero.

Distributive Property (Advanced but Simple Idea)
👉 5 × (2 + 3)
= (5 × 2) + (5 × 3)
= 10 + 15 = 25

FAQs About Multiplication in Math
What is multiplication in simple words?
It is a fast way of adding the same number many times.
Is multiplication only repeated addition?
At basic level yes, but it also shows scaling and patterns.
What are factors in multiplication?
Numbers that are multiplied together are called factors.
Why do we use multiplication?
To make calculations faster and easier in daily life.
What is product in math?
The answer you get after multiplying numbers.
